                Originally posted by littlejake
                A COE cannot be renewed after one year without new livescan fingerprints. What fool came up with that? Was it codified in the law; or is it just some rule CA DOJ BOF came up with???

                I don't get the point since fingerprints don't change. And if one must reapply with fingerprints -- what's the point of putting ones former COE numer on the application.


                Its because they don't keep fingerprints on file so they can't 'run' them again. (This is a good thing).

                Referencing your old COE simplifies processing in case of Name/address changes etc. It also keeps the system from having multiple certs for the same person.

                All CA departments seem to have this '1-year' Livescan rule, so this isn't something that BOF came up with on-the-fly.

                Fingerprints don't change, but people sometimes do. Barring storing fingerprints (bad thing), this is the only way they have to check on whether you're still an upstanding citizen.
